Description

We are looking for a Network Specialist to join our team working with an EU agency in the historic city of Strasbourg, seat of the European Parliament and home to many prestigious EU agencies.

Working under our contract with eu-LISA, you will help our client accomplish their mission of supporting all the EU member states for a safer Europe through technology.

Tasks will include:

  • Perform QA and QR (develop/update/review) on network design, network test and network installation plus its documentation & specifications;
  • Construct and maintain configurations for data networks;
  • Migrate and/or coordinate migration of network services involving several parties;
  • Perform troubleshooting of network problems utilising network analysers and/or sniffers and other troubleshooting tools;
  • Configure and implement network monitoring and management systems;
  • Implement and monitor network security;
  • Preparation, Planning and Execution of migrations of Network Services.

We are looking for candidates with the following profile:

  • Minimum 4 years of relevant education (Master or equivalent) after the secondary school and minimum 3 years of relevant IT experience;
  • At least 2 years of experience with proven expertise in Network migration;
  • Experience in the following topics:
    • DNS and IP administration;
    • TCP/IP, RIP, OSPF, BGP and/or EIGRP;
    • Network Management tools;
  • Ability to understand/review documentation and technical specifications related to network infrastructures;
  • In depth knowledge of network design, network capacity planning, network evolutions, network monitoring, network configurations;
  • Advanced/In depth knowledge of the domains of Internet-Protocol, Firewall administration, Firewall/VPN/load balancer configuration and troubleshooting (Cisco, Stonegate, F5 products are a plus);
  • Advanced/In depth knowledge of network configuration and troubleshooting like DNS, VLAN, IP routing, LAN, WAN;
  • Very good knowledge of encryption at network layer and encryption protocols (SSL/TLS, IPSEC, etc.);
  • In depth knowledge of the concepts related to load balancing, Firewalls, Switches (L2/L3), redundancy, IP Addressing;
  • Fluent English. French skills are not required;
  • Candidate should be eligible for EU Security Clearance.
